I've been accepted into this coming Fall program. When I originally applied I thought I only had an 3.68 but after talking to the advisor it was actually 3.74 and my HESI was an 87 with a critical thinking score of 970 out of 1000.

You're going to do fine. As far as the math went I remembered seeing a lot of fractions and ratio questions. But honestly most of it was basic math, like literally basic. There's a calculator on the screen that you can use as well, oh and they give you scrap paper if you need it!
